Ibugesic Tablet is a good pain killer when the pain is musculo skeletal at the dose of about 400 mg 3 times a day after food. Acidity and fluid retention may be side effect after prolonged use. For chest pain you may have to see a Physician for proper clinical examination, related investigations, diagnosis and treatment.

Unfortunately what you have read is partially correct. Active ingredients of ibugesic plus are paracetamol and ibuprofen. Ibuprofen is licensed for use even in premature babies. Please discuss your concerns with your doctor.
